* WHAT...Flooding caused by excessive rainfall is possible.
* WHERE...Portions of southwest Virginia, including the following
area, Tazewell and southeast West Virginia, including the
following areas, Eastern Greenbrier, Mercer, Monroe, Summers and
Western Greenbrier.
* WHEN...From noon EDT today through this evening.
* IMPACTS...Excessive runoff may result in flooding of rivers,
creeks, streams, and other low-lying and flood-prone locations.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- An upper level disturbance will interact with ample moisture
and a front to bring scattered showers and thunderstorms to
the region. Flash flooding will be possible in heavier or
training storms.
